Abdul Sattar Edhi, Pakistan's 'Father Teresa'

enter image description here

Abdul Sattar Edhi was born in 1928 in a small village of Bantva near Joona Garh, Gujrat (India). Abdul Sattar Edhi began his humatarian work in Pakistan soon after partition of Pakistan and India in 1947. He has created The Edhi foundation with just $500, He began by working for the people of karachi and went on to the centre of providing various services.

Abdul Sattar Edhi: Why Google honours him today:

enter image description here

Abdul Sattar Edhi established the world's biggest volunteer rescue ambulance service in Pakistan, The Edhi Ambulance service.Not at all like affluent people that reserve philanthropies in their names, Edhi committed his life to the poor from the age of 20, when he himself was destitute in Karachi. The scope of Edhi's establishment developed globally, and in 2005 the association brought $100,000 up in help alleviation for the casualties of Hurricane Katrina.

AWARDS AND ACHIEVEMENTS:

enter image description here

International awards
Ramon Magsaysay Award for Public Service (1986)
Lenin Peace Prize (1988)
Paul Harris Fellow from Rotary International (1993)[70]
Peace Prize from the former USSR, for services during the Armenian earthquake disaster (1988)
Hamdan Award for volunteers in Humanitarian Medical Services (2000), UAE[70]
International Balzan Prize (2000) for Humanity, Peace and Brotherhood, Italy[70]
Peace and Harmony Award (2001), Delhi
Peace Award (2004), Mumbai
Peace Award (2005), Hyderabad Deccan
Gandhi Peace Award (2007), Delhi
Peace Award (2008), Seoul
Honorary doctorate from the Institute of Business Administration Karachi (2006).
UNESCO-Madanjeet Singh Prize (2009)
Ahmadiyya Muslim Peace Prize (2010)
Honorary Doctorate by the University of Bedfordshire (2010)[75]

National awards

Silver Jubilee Shield by College of Physicians and Surgeons (1962–1987)
Moiz ur rehman Award (2015)
The Social Worker of Sub-Continent by Government of Sindh (1989)
Nishan-e-Imtiaz, civil decoration from the Government of Pakistan (1989)
Recognition of meritorious services to oppressed humanity during the 1980s by Ministry of Health and Social Welfare, Government of Pakistan (1989)
Pakistan Civic Award from the Pakistan Civic Society (1992)
Jinnah Award for Outstanding Services to Pakistan was conferred in April 1998 by The Jinnah Society. This was the first Jinnah Award conferred on any person in Pakistan.
Shield of Honor by Pakistan Army
Khidmat Award by the Pakistan Academy of Medical Sciences
Bacha Khan Aman (Peace) Award in 1991
Human Rights Award by Pakistan Human Rights Society
2013 Person of the Year by the readers of The Express Tribune

Nobel Peace Prize

Throughout his life and after he died, many questioned why Edhi never received the Nobel Peace Prize. Edhi said: "I don't care about it. The Nobel Prize doesn't mean anything to me. I want these people, I want humanity."

He died last year in Karachi of renal failure. He was offered treatment abroad, but insisted on being treated in a government hospital at home. NawazSharif announced a national day of mourning and a state funeral, the first time anyone has been so honoured since General Zia ul-Haq, the military dictator who died in a plane crash in 1988.

“If anyone deserves to be wrapped in the flag of the nation he served, it is him,” Sharif said.
